In his best match of the season for Borussia Dortmund, Christian Pulisic willed short-handed BVB to a 1-1 draw at Hoffenheim with the tying goal in the 84th minute.
Pulisic got
open in the front of goal to put away Marco Reus' cross for his second goal of the week. He scored the winning goal in Dortmund's 1-0 win over Club Brugge on Tuesday when he celebrated his 20th
birthday.
The American consistently went at defenders in the second half. He set up Japanese midfielder Shinji Kagawa for a chance that just went wide.
Dortmund played
the last 15 minutes with 10 men after a red card to young Frenchman Abdou Diallo.
It sits in a tie for third place with eight points after four games in the Bundesliga.
